Найти в Дзене
HackWorld

SSH-клиент для Linux: средство удалённого администрирования серверов

Некоторые люди могли задуматься: могу ли я удалённо работать с командной строкой через Linux? Ответ: да, можете! Для этого специально был придуман протокол SSH, позволяющий удалённо админить сервера, на которых стоит SSH-сервер.

Некоторые люди могли задуматься: могу ли я удалённо работать с командной строкой через Linux? Ответ: да, можете! Для этого специально был придуман протокол SSH, позволяющий удалённо админить сервера, на которых стоит SSH-сервер.

Кратко о SSH: SSH (англ. Secure Shell — «безопасная оболочка») — сетевой протокол, который позволяет производить удалённое администрирование и управление операционной системой. Схож по функциональности с Telnet. но, в отличие от него, шифрует весь трафик, в том числе и передаваемые пароли, делая соединение безопасным. SSH-клиенты и SSH-серверы доступны для большинства сетевых операционных систем, как Windows, так и Linux, и даже BSD, MacOS, и Solaris.

Итак, как же нам через Linux подключится к серверу по SSH? Для этого потребуется установить SSH-клиент (программа, которая коннектится к ssh-серверу (сервер же является программой, позволяющей клиентам подключаться у ней) ). Сейчас мы опустим момент, связанный с SSH-сервером, так как это растянется на долго, поэтому про сервер я расскажу в следующей статье.

И что-же насчёт клиента? мы будем использовать OpenSSH. Для его установки потребуется эта команда:

pkg install openssh

Итак, клиент установлен. После этого, когда мы хотим подключиться, мы вводим эту команду:

ssh [имя пользователя]@[адрес сервера]:[порт]

Тут придётся остановиться поподробнее. Там, где нужно ввести имя пользователя, мы должны, ввести имя пользователя. Логично, не правда ли? =D

Там где нужно ввести адрес сервера мы должны будем ввести либо IP сервера, либо прикреплённый домен.

Порт: чаще всего, порт прописывать не нужно, поэтому его можно и не трогать.

Вот пример записи команды:

пример записи команды
пример записи команды

После этого будет подключение к серверу и авторизация пользователя, где нужно будет ввести пароль от него

ВАЖНО: так как мы подключаемся через Linux, пароль при вводе не будет видно!

Если вы всё сделали правильно и ввели корректный пароль, то вы авторизируетесь и получите доступ!

И на этом всё, ставьте лайки!